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ol vs. 1301 Tactical
The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ol is the latest addition to Beretta’s semi-automatic shotgun lineup, designed for tactical, home defense, and law enforcement use. It’s often compared to the Beretta 1301 Tactical, another top-tier combat shotgun. But how do they stack up against each other?
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ol vs. 1301 Tactical – Key Differences
Feature |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ol | Beretta 1301 Tactical |
---|---|---|
Action | Gas-operated | Gas-operated |
Gauge | 12 gauge | 12 gauge |
Barrel Length | 19.1 inches | 18.5 inches |
Overall Length | 38 inches | 37.8 inches |
Weight | 7.1 lbs | 6.4 lbs |
Magazine Capacity | 7+1 rounds | 7+1 rounds |
Choke System | Mobilchoke | Optima HP |
Recoil System | Standard gas recoil | BLINK gas system (40% faster cycling) |
Price | $1,099 – $1,299 | $1,499 – $1,799 |
Primary Use | Tactical, home defense, competition | Law enforcement, home defense, competition |
1. Design & Build Quality
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ol
The A300 Ultima Patrol is a rugged and affordable tactical shotgun. It features:
✔ Steelium Barrel: 19.1-inch chrome-lined barrel for durability.
✔ 7+1 Capacity: More rounds than many competitors.
✔ Oversized Controls: Large bolt handle, safety, and bolt release for easy manipulation.
✔ M-LOK Compatibility: Allows for mounting lights, grips, and other accessories.
Beretta 1301 Tactical
The 1301 Tactical is a premium law enforcement and defense shotgun with:
✔ BLINK Gas System: Cycles 40% faster than competitors.
✔ Lighter Weight: At 6.4 lbs, it’s easier to maneuver.
✔ Optima HP Choke System: Improves accuracy and versatility.
Winner: Beretta 1301 Tactical for premium build and speed, but the A300 Ultima Patrol is more budget-friendly.
2. Performance & Recoil Management
The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ol and Beretta 1301 Tactical both use gas-operated systems, but the 1301 Tactical features BLINK technology, making it one of the fastest-cycling semi-auto shotguns available.
Recoil Comparison:
-
A300 Ultima Patrol: Standard gas recoil system with manageable kick.
-
1301 Tactical: 40% faster cycling reduces recoil significantly, allowing for faster follow-up shots.
Winner: Beretta 1301 Tactical for smoother and faster cycling.

4. Price & Value
Shotgun | Price Range | Best Use Case |
---|---|---|
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ol | $1099 – $1,299 | Budget tactical shotgun, home defense, range use |
Beretta 1301 Tactical | $1,499 – $1,799 | Professional use, law enforcement, competition |
For those looking for a high-quality semi-auto shotgun at a lower price, the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ol is the best value. However, if you want top-tier performance and ultra-fast cycling, the 1301 Tactical is worth the extra cost.
Winner: Beretta A300 Ultima Patrol for budget-conscious buyers.
